What to Do When a Dashboard Light Activates

When a dashboard light illuminates, it signals you to take immediate action. Knowing what to do can save time and prevent further damage.

Immediate Action Steps for Flashing Symbols

  • For red lights: Stop driving immediately and seek assistance as the issue is critical.

  • For yellow/orange lights: Note the alert and arrange to have your vehicle serviced within the next 48 hours to avoid potential problems.

  • For blue/green lights: Recognize these as informational notifications that do not require urgent intervention.

Priority Alert Hierarchy

Ensure you understand the urgency associated with each color:

Color

Meaning

Response Time

Red

Critical system failure

Immediate (stop driving)

Amber

Service required

Within 2 days

Green

System active/monitor

Regular observation

Complete 2025 Nissan Altima Warning Lights Guide

Your dashboard is designed to provide crucial information about your car’s systems. Here’s how to interpret the most common symbols:

Engine-Related Symbols

Check Engine Light (CEL):

  • When solid, it often indicates an emissions-related issue that might be more prevalent under the harsh and dusty conditions some drivers experience.

  • If the light flashes, it suggests a misfire, necessitating an immediate inspection.

Oil Pressure Warning:

  • If the oil pressure indicator activates, you should check your oil levels within 15 minutes. Low oil pressure can harm engine performance, especially in extreme weather.

  • In regions with high ambient temperatures, such as the hot parts of the GCC, ensuring proper oil levels can be critical to prevent engine damage.

Safety System Indicators

Automatic Emergency Braking (AEB) Alert:

  • When this alert appears, it may indicate that the sensors need cleaning; maintaining clean sensors is essential for optimal system performance. Consider cleaning them every few months if you drive in dusty conditions.

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S):

  • This symbol reminds you to check that your tire pressures are within the optimal range (typically 33-35 PSI when tires are cold). Proper tire pressure is vital to avoid uneven wear and potential hazards on the road.

Maintenance Tips for Dashboard Alerts

Caring for your vehicle regularly can prevent sudden issues on the road. Here are some practical maintenance tips:

Preventative Care Schedule

Monthly Checks:

  • Inspect fluid levels

  • Verify tire pressure

  • Test warning lights to ensure they are functioning correctly

Annual Services:

  • Undergo a comprehensive system diagnostic

  • Calibrate sensors to maintain accuracy

DIY Reset Procedures

Resetting basic dashboard warnings can sometimes be done without a service center visit:

  1. Turn the ignition to the "ON" position without starting the engine.

  2. Press the trip or reset button three times.

  3. Start the engine and wait while the system recalibrates.

  4. Hold the button until the indicator light blinks or disappears.

Common systems you might reset include maintenance reminders, the TPMS (after ensuring proper tire inflation), and door ajar alerts.

FAQ

Q1:What should I do if a red warning light comes on in my Nissan Altima?

When a red warning light illuminates, it indicates a severe problem such as engine failure or critical system malfunction. You should pull over safely and avoid driving further until the issue is diagnosed. Contact a trusted service center promptly to prevent further damage. Remember that safety is paramount, and immediate action can help avert dangerous situations.

Q2:How frequently should I check my tire pressure as indicated by the TPMS?

It is advisable to check your tire pressures on a monthly basis, especially in regions where temperature fluctuations are common. Keeping the pressure within the recommended range (33-35 PSI for cold tires) ensures optimal handling and tire longevity. Regular monitoring can help you avoid potential issues caused by under-inflated or over-inflated tires. This simple practice contributes significantly to overall vehicle safety.

Q3:Can I reset the dashboard warning lights myself?

Yes, many dashboard warnings, such as maintenance reminders and TPMS alerts, can often be reset without a visit to the service center. Following a basic reset procedure—turning the ignition on, using the trip button, and waiting until the indicator blinks—can resolve minor issues. However, if a warning light persists even after a reset, it is a strong indication that professional diagnosis is needed. When in doubt, consulting the vehicle’s manual or a trusted mechanic is recommended.

Q4:Why do my dashboard lights sometimes only flash and then turn off?

Flashing lights can serve as a system alert, drawing your attention to a potential issue. They may indicate temporary sensor malfunctions or a system that needs calibration. If the light disappears after a short while and normal driving resumes, it could simply be a momentary glitch. Nonetheless, if the flashing continues or recurs frequently, it warrants a check-up at a certified service center to ensure there isn’t an underlying problem.

Q5:How can I maintain the sensors involved with safety systems like AEB?

Maintaining sensors is crucial to ensure the proper functioning of safety systems such as Automatic Emergency Braking (AEB). Clean the sensors regularly—ideally every three months, especially if you drive in dusty or sandy areas—to guarantee accurate readings. Consult your vehicle’s manual for the recommended cleaning procedures. Proper maintenance of these sensors can enhance their performance and extend the system’s lifespan.
